Aluminum Windows Service Questions
What are aluminum windows? Aluminum windows are frames made from lightweight, durable metal known for strength and low maintenance, suitable for various property styles.
Are aluminum windows energy-efficient? Modern aluminum windows often include thermal breaks and insulation to improve energy performance and reduce heat transfer.
What types of aluminum window styles are available? Common styles include casement, sliding, awning, and fixed windows, offering options for ventilation and natural light.
How long do aluminum windows typically last? Aluminum windows can last several decades with proper maintenance, resisting rust and corrosion over time.
